The offspring of a brooding sea anemone transition from using egg yolks to pre-natal, then post-natal, parental feeding during their development, according to a study published April 22, 2016 in the open - access journal PLOS ONE by Annie Mercier from Memorial University, Canada, and colleagues.
The authors of the present study characterized the brooding process of Aulactinia stella, a live - bearing sea anemone found in Atlantic Canada, and compared the fatty acid make - up of adults and juveniles to detect shifts in nutritional resources during development.
